Job Description: Blockchain & Digital Asset Risk Consulting Senior Manager Role Summary This role will lead the design, build, and scale of operational and risk management functions for financial institutions and FinTechs operating in stablecoins, tokenized assets, and blockchain-enabled financial infrastructure. The role will bring hands-on experience supporting regulated entities through the full lifecycle of digital-asset initiatives, from concept and regulatory engagement through implementation, operation, and examination. This role sits at the intersection of regulatory credibility, operational execution, and emerging technology, and is central to Crowe’s strategy to defend and advance its financial services franchise.

Responsibilities

  • Lead complex consulting engagements supporting stablecoin issuance, tokenized deposits, custody, settlement, and blockchain-enabled payments.
  • Advise clients on the design and launch of stablecoin programs, including governance models, reserve management, issuance/redemption controls, and disclosures.
  • Design and implement enterprise, operational, and technology risk management frameworks aligned to blockchain-based financial products.
  • Translate regulatory expectations (OCC, Federal Reserve, state regulators, global regulators where applicable) into practical, defensible operating models.
  • Build policies, procedures, control frameworks, RCSAs, and internal audit programs for digital-asset activities.
  • Support regulatory exams, supervisory feedback, and remediation efforts related to digital assets and distributed ledger technology.
  • Lead selection, assessment, and integration of third-party vendors, including custody providers, blockchain analytics platforms, transaction monitoring tools, and wallet/key management solutions.
  • Develop scalable toolkits, methodologies, and reference architectures to support repeatable delivery across Crowe’s diverse practices.
  • Serve as a subject matter leader and mentor, contributing to internal capability development, thought leadership, and go-to-market initiatives.
